L221 HRF is a 1993 Renault Trafic in White with a 2,068c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 27 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 51.9%.

Across all 1993 Renault Trafic models, the average MOT pass rate is 61.7% with a typical mileage of 77,432 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Renault Trafic fails its MOT is track rod end ball joint has excessive play, accounting for 87,451 recorded failures. If you're considering buying L221 HRF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Renault Trafic typ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 33 years old, this Renault Trafic is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
